基于黑板推理与分层规划的CGF模糊决策模型

摘    要:计算机生成兵力具有智能行为是其最大的特点,也是当前研究的重点和难点。为了使计算机生成兵力决策的智能化水平有所提高,把复杂的决策过程进行分层规划,将各层中决策子任务的求解策略、推理策略与黑板推理方法中的多任务协同工作原理相结合,构造了基于黑板推理的计算机生成兵力决策模型。同时,也将模糊理论应用到决策模型中。有效地提高了计算机生成兵力的智能水平。

关 键 词:黑板推理  计算机生成兵力  分层规划  智能决策

CGF fuzzy decision-making model based on hierarchical planning and blackboard reasoning

Abstract:It is essential characteristic that computer generated forces possesses intelligent behavior, it is also the difficulty and the emphasis of current research. Hierarchical planning of complex decision process is carried out to improve computer generated forces intelligence. A computer generated forces intelligent decision model is developed combing the strategies of sub-task solving and the strategies of reasoning with multi-task coordination principle used in blackboard reasoning. Meanwhile, fuzzy theory is applied to decision module. Intelligence of computer generated forces is improved.
Keywords:blackboard reasoning  computer generated forces  hierarchical planning  intelligent decision
